OCZ Vertex 2 - SandForce

The Vertex 2 we are testing today is an 2.5" SATA II 100 GB version. You should easily be able to place it somewhere in your chassis. The product is a prototype with non-final performance numbers.

OCZ Vertex 2 - SandForce

And though the photo would make you think otherwise, of course, it's a perfect fit for laptops. This SSD would bring a whole lot of performance onto that laptop alright, all at low power consumption at 2 Watt and virtually no heat.

OCZ Vertex 2 - SandForce

Slim and light-weight, 9.5mm tall, it's the standard for notebook drives. When we look at the connectors, we spot the standard power and SATA connector, this drive is SATA2 compatible.  We hope to see SATA3 support on SSDs soon.

Installation wise it's the same as a traditional HDD. Pop it in, connect it, bind it, format it and you are good to go at horribly fast speeds. It uses the same connectors as any other SATA storage device.
